Chart Industries announced that its Distribution & Storage (D&S) business in China has been awarded a contract to provide self-contained liquefied natural gas (LNG) station modules to Kunlun Energy Investment, a wholly owned subsidiary of PetroChina’s Kunlun Energy.

The contract value of this order is in excess of $50 million and is in addition to the $45 million PetroChina order the Company received and announced in April 2013.

“This is the third major award from PetroChina in the last several quarters which highlights their continuing commitment to the LNG infrastructure build-out in China and we are very pleased they have chosen Chart again in recognition of our quality and product capabilities,” stated Tom Carey, President of Chart ‘s D&S Group .
